To Those people of you who're stating that posing with deceased siblings is influencing the kids, I might indicate that you've got minimal knowledge of how Dying was addressed right now. Funeral residences were not that well-liked nonetheless and most funerals came about in your own home. The deceased could be displayed within the "Parlor" (What we simply call the "Living Room" nowadays, which you'll be able to thank the Funeral market for) and Death was considerably more prevalent.

About one/3 of the above had been alive. many of them are laughable. The person in the leather chair is well-known. He's Lewis Carroll who wrote Alice in Wonderland. We know he was alive in that Image. Anyone standing was alive. Stands were ONLY accustomed to assist keep the residing nonetheless for prolonged shutter exposures that can previous as much as forty five seconds.

Any of the above mentioned images wherever the person is standing is a photograph of the Dwell man or woman. Sorry, although the Victorian standing postmortem photo is an online myth. Stands had been ONLY utilized to help hold the dwelling nevertheless for extensive shutter exposures that can last as much as 45 seconds.

there are various genuine article mortem photographs created and plenty of proven Allow me to share without a doubt publish mortems. Having said that ALL the standing and several other in the Other people are incredibly everyday pictures or quite alive men and women. I have analyzed and taught the history of pictures and collected put up mortems for in excess of thirty years and I am appalled in the incorrect facts which is flooding the web and with the a number of sellers on eBay of blatantly mislabeled article mortem photographs. I've performed intensive investigate in the region of Victorian day-to-working day practices and funerary customs. article-mortem photography (if it could be afforded) was as much a Portion of Victorian existence as fashionable-working day rituals are to us within the twenty first century. It was neither morbid, gross, nor disrespectful, actually, quite the alternative. The reason was not merely to seize a loved one particular's visage for a long-lasting souvenir but it absolutely was also thought of a highly regarded celebration of 1's life, as long or as shorter as it was. And sorry to bust your assert that a standing publish-mortem Image is a web fantasy.....as it certainly just isn't! I've a post-mortem Picture of the ancestral youthful adult relative who was "standing". - She was propped up by her waist which was cinched (hidden In most cases by a draped shawl)to a heavy iron prop stand symbolizing a fence submit. And her head was held up by a Reside man or woman standing powering and protected in a cloak that blended Together with the backdrop. Her eyes had been In a natural way open up as is the case with a lot of deceased people but her gaze was not on the digital camera. The Picture was taken around ten hrs following Dying. These information were being all very carefully documented by the lady's sister in her diary. without having this information and facts, you wouldn't have considered the person while in the Photograph was dead. Upon quite close inspection, I had been able to confirm just what the diary revealed. This can be precisely what sparked my fascination In this particular material! The problem of your body and realism in the article-mortem photo is immediately dependent upon how soon a photo may be taken next The instant of Demise (apart from in the case of injury by fire, other incident or possibly a disfiguring condition) The photographs where the topics seem like totally alive had been without a doubt taken within just hrs, around per day soon after Loss of life. A entire body is usually easily posed throughout the 1st handful of hrs ahead of rigor mortis usually takes maintain, initial With all the facial functions, which include eyelids.
